The manager must understand that there exists a moral factor. Awareness of this problem poses a new leader: What should be the ideal for the work of subordinates.In answering this question, we should not seek to over- specificity and originality. Take into account the difference in taste and judgment of each is rarely possible, so the head is usually committed to improving the integrated performance. With the following factors at the head of a chance of getting the consent of the maximum number of subordinates. So, the ideal job is to:• To have integrity, that is, lead to a certain result;• Valued employees as important and deserves to be executed;• Enable the employee to take the decisions necessary for its implementation, i.e. must be autonomous (within limits). Or, alternatively, - group autonomy;• To provide feedback to the employee, measured as a function of the effectiveness of its work;• To bring the fair from the point of view of employee compensation.Designed in accordance with these principles work provides inner satisfaction.
